// REINDEX_BATCH_CAP limits docs per shard pass in the Tallowfield
// nightly search reindex. Raising it starves the ingest queue;
// lowering it overruns the maintenance window. 5000 is the tested
// sweet spot. Change only with a soak run. Verified against the
// build noted below.

session token of bawif-hahog = htk6_ac5981

// Heads up, reviewer: these knobs drive DocSnipe, our docs linter.
// They control how aggressively we flag stale code samples and
// broken cross-references. We learned the hard way (the Tarnby docs
// sprint, ugh) that overly strict thresholds bury real issues in
// noise, so please don't crank these without checking the false-
// positive dashboard first. The constants we settled on are below.

tuning constants:
BUDGETS = {
    "druath": 240,
    "lamwyn": 180,
    "silael": 275,
}

Ticket: Staging env misconfigured for Siftgate bloom filter

The bloom layer in front of the Pellet KV store is rejecting all lookups in staging because the env file was copied from the dev template without credentials. False-positive tuning values are fine; only the auth line is missing. To unblock the weekly demo, the Pellet admission secret must be set on the following line.

env line for yaguf-fajop: LEDGER_TOKEN13=fb08984397349

Subject: DR drill Thursday — strings extractor

Team,

Thursday we run the quarterly disaster-recovery drill for the Lornquist translation-string extraction script. Scenario: the primary Hexby runner is gone. You will restore the extractor from the cold backup, re-run extraction against the Pellwood repo, and diff output against last week's snapshot. Mismatches over 2% mean the restore failed. New folks: shadow a senior for the first run, then do the second solo. Restore access to the backup vault requires the recovery passphrase below.

vault phrase of tajeg-tageg = pelix-druix-holius-briael-zorwyn-frawyn-fraox-norok-drueth-aldiel